ThFri 5.24 27 Drawing-onMoone event will showcase more than 120 local, national, and international live and electronic music acts of a variety of genres, from African to experimental, on five stages; art and film; dance, and theater performances; workshops, yoga, massage, health practices, local vendors and artisans, raw cacao ceremonies and gourmet health food.

The site of the festival is on top of a mountain in Malibu, 2000 feet above sea level, on more than 25 acres. Surrounded by rolling hills, mountains, the ocean; the property also includes eco-sustainable vineyards, orchards, a zoo, a sweat lodge, tipi, yurt, and numerous custom structures created by fierce environmentalist Debra Malmazada over the last 20 years.

How bout’ some storytelling? No it’s not stand up comedy….though it is funny, It’s very much like theaterl but more of a one person show…each person stands and spurts out their own original monologue…some amusing, some hysterical, some bizarre.

The LA Story Fix produced by Peter Coca and Jamie Virostko.

The event features the funniest storytellers in LA….It’s a fun get together that happens every 4th Sunday of the month.

This week’s storytellers moves to a new location in Silver Lake. The show includes: Peter Coca, Jenny Noa, Clinton Oie, Alex Stein, Jamie Virostko, and  more. Plus, enjoy music by Lady Basco.
